Hrm… that’s a tough one for skills. I guess we’ll start with the swords.
1 would be your basic auto attack, with Slash→Stab→Twirl. Twirl could potentially be a projectile finisher. At melee range it’d really only hit who you’re targeting.
2 could be an evasive leaping swing that does more damage the closer you are. At a distance, it’d do less damage but carry you to your target. At close range (under 200?) it’d operate as a quick evade. In both cases it’s a leap finisher.
3 would be a flurry of 10 weak attacks, with a twirling sword motion. Each attack would have a 20% chance to activate a projectile finisher. For the purposes of the class, this entire set would be under the gimmicks “combo field”; so you could proc fire or other skills multiple times.
I assume most attack sets would do overall weaker DPS then say a warrior, or a ranger; but make up for it in the number of finishers they have and can activate.
